Hi Miguel,
This is a limitation of OSPF-MIB, which has no mechanism to support multiple processes.
Apparently adding an extra index and calling it v2 is too hard. :D

On 9 October 2015 12:07:41 pm Miguel Berniz mberniz@gibfibrespeed.net wrote:
Hello,
I have noticed only 1 OSPF process is detected on cisco devices. I have a Catalyst 4500 with 3 processes but only one of them is handle by observium.
Is this the normal behavior or does it require special config or not supported at all?
